Data Protection Advisor (DPA):DPA 代理程式無法使用 exception.name_conflict 錯誤註冊至應用程式伺服器

Summary: DPA 代理程式無法在有 exception.name_conflict 錯誤的情況中註冊至應用程式伺服器

This article applies to This article does not apply to This article is not tied to any specific product. Not all product versions are identified in this article.

Symptoms

新安裝的 DPA 代理程式無法註冊至 DPA 應用程式伺服器。在 dpaagent 記錄中,下列錯誤指出由於名稱衝突導致註冊失敗:      
< 錯誤 >
< id > exception.name_conflict </id >
< 的 message > 已存在同名的別名。請選擇其他名稱 </message >
< 專案名稱 = "type" > 別名 </entry >
</Error >
ERR 18330.18330 20210304:210609 代理程式. config-initAgentConfig ():無法向伺服器註冊代理程式。正在等待重新嘗試 .。。

但是,即使已啟用代理程式調試低層級,上述錯誤也不會提供確切的衝突名稱。

Cause

代理程式註冊失敗是由於 dpaagent 記錄中所示的名稱衝突所造成。移除造成衝突的 hostname 後,代理程式就能在 DPA 應用程式伺服器上成功註冊。

Resolution

即使啟用調試低層級,也不會在 dpaagent 記錄中找到衝突名稱,因為 DPA 應用程式伺服器會追蹤此資訊。若要判斷衝突名稱並解決問題,請按照以下步驟操作:      
  1. 存取 DPA 應用程式伺服器,然後流覽至伺服器。 < DPA 安裝目錄下的記錄 >/services/logs/。
  2. 在伺服器 .log 中,搜尋關鍵字「節點已找到」。應看到類似以下的內容:      
2021-03-05 09:54:53114錯誤 [apollo,UpdateNodeCommandBean] (HTTP-/0.0.0.0: 9002-3)已找到使用新別名的節點 XXXXXX 現有的 nodeElement 名稱:YYYYYY
09:54:53114錯誤 [org jboss. as. ejb3] (HTTP-/0.0.0.0: 9002-3) javax. ejb. EJBTransactionRolledbackException:名稱相同的別名已經存在。請選擇其他名稱(exception.name_conflict)
  1. 前往 DPA GUI > 清查 > 物件程式庫 > 主機標籤,然後搜尋主機 YYYYYY。
  2. 選取 host YYYYYY 的 properties (> 別名)區段,然後尋找衝突名稱 XXXXXX。
  3. 如果有問題,請複製所有別名名稱。
  4. 選取別名名稱 XXXXXX,然後按一下 Delete (刪除)。
  5. 按一下套用,然後按一下確定。
  6. 重新開機未能註冊的 DPA 代理程式,而且應該能夠註冊 DPA 應用程式伺服器。
如果代理程式仍無法註冊,請檢查更新的代理程式記錄是否因其他錯誤或問題現在可能會發生。可能存在其他名稱衝突錯誤,必須使用上述步驟解決。

請聯絡 Dell EMC 技術支援小組,以取得進一步的詳細資料或資訊。

Affected Products

Data Protection Advisor
Article Properties
Article Number: 000183846
Article Type: Solution
Last Modified: 23 Jul 2021
Version:  4
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.